Earthquake anxiety and sleep quality among adolescent survivors 9–12 months after the great earthquakes in Türkiye: a cross-sectional study
Abstract This study investigated the relationship between earthquake-related anxiety and sleep quality among adolescents affected by a major earthquake in Türkiye. An analytical cross-sectional design was employed, involving 402 adolescents aged 12–18 years from Kahramanmaraş, Kilis, Diyarbakır, Ada...
